Solution
1. Preparation
  • Gather tools and parts needed.
  • Ensure the vehicle is parked in a safe, well-ventilated area.
  • Disconnect the negative battery terminal using a wrench to prevent electrical shock.
2. Clean Battery Terminals
  • Remove the positive and negative battery terminals using a socket set.
  • Clean the terminals and cable ends with a wire brush to remove any corrosion.
  • Reattach the terminals securely.
3. Replace Battery (if necessary)
  • If the battery voltage is low or it cannot hold a charge, replace it.
  • Remove the old battery using a socket set and carefully lift it out of the tray.
  • Place the new battery in the tray, ensuring it is oriented correctly.
  • Connect the positive terminal first, followed by the negative terminal.
4. Test and Replace Faulty Components
  • If the alternator was found to be faulty, replace it.
    • Disconnect the battery again.
    • Remove the alternator belt and any bolts securing the alternator.
    • Install the new alternator, tightening bolts to the manufacturer's specifications.
    • Reconnect the battery.
5. Address Parasitic Draw
  • If excessive draw was detected, identify the circuit causing it.
  • Unplug components one by one (e.g., radio, lights) until the draw stops.
  • Repair or replace the faulty component as necessary.
